Part Overview
The MAX4462TESA+ is a single-channel instrumentation amplifier manufactured by Analog Devices Inc./Maxim Integrated, housed in an 8-SOIC surface mount package. This device features rail-to-rail output capability and is designed for precision signal conditioning applications requiring low input offset voltage and minimal input bias current.
The MAX4462TESA+ is classified as obsolete. Locating equivalent substitute parts is necessary to support ongoing production requirements, system maintenance, and design continuity where this component was originally specified.

Engineering Selection Recommendations
The MAX4461TESA+ is a direct parametric equivalent to the MAX4462TESA+. All electrical specifications, mechanical dimensions, and compliance certifications are identical.
Key Advantages of MAX4461TESA+ Selection:
The MAX4461TESA+ carries an Active product status, ensuring ongoing manufacturer support, availability, and compliance maintenance. The MAX4462TESA+ is classified as Obsolete, which restricts future availability and support.
Both parts are ROHS3 Compliant, REACH Unaffected, and classified under ECCN EAR99, meeting identical regulatory requirements for industrial and commercial applications.
The MAX4461TESA+ is currently available in higher inventory quantities (1801 Pcs) compared to the MAX4462TESA+ (725 Pcs), supporting immediate procurement needs.
No electrical performance trade-offs exist between these parts. The substitution is direct and does not require circuit redesign, board layout modification, or firmware changes.
